uniapp仿抖音分享视频
时间: 2023-09-19 17:08:42 浏览: 99
你可以使用uniapp来开发一个仿抖音分享视频的应用。首先,你可以创建一个uniapp项目并设置好基本的配置。然后,你可以使用uniapp提供的组件和API来实现视频的播放、分享等功能。
在页面中,你可以使用uniapp的video组件来展示视频,并通过设置src属性来加载视频资源。你还可以使用uniapp的swiper组件来实现左右滑动切换不同的视频。
为了实现视频的分享功能,你可以使用uniapp的分享API,将分享按钮放置在页面中,并在点击分享按钮时调用相关API完成分享操作。你可以使用uniapp的社交分享组件或自定义分享逻辑来实现这一功能。
除了视频播放和分享功能,你还可以根据仿抖音的需求添加其他的功能,如用户登录、评论、点赞等。你可以使用uniapp提供的各种组件和API来实现这些功能。
总结来说,uniapp是一个跨平台的开发框架,可以让你使用Vue.js开发一次代码,同时在多个平台上运行。通过使用uniapp提供的组件和API,你可以快速实现一个仿抖音分享视频的应用。希望对你有所帮助!如还有其他问题,请继续提问。
相关问题
uniapp仿抖音源码
### 回答1:
UniApp是一个跨平台的开发框架,可以同时开发iOS、Android、H5等多个平台的应用程序。仿抖音源码意味着可以使用UniApp来开发类似抖音的短视频应用程序。
首先,我们可以使用UniApp提供的各种组件和API来实现类似抖音的界面和功能。例如,可以使用uni-list组件来展示视频列表,uni-video组件用于播放视频,uni-button组件用于实现点赞、评论、分享等操作。
其次,为了实现抖音的滑动效果,我们可以使用uni-app的swiper组件,结合手势事件来实现视频的左右滑动功能。这样用户可以通过左右滑动来切换不同的视频。
另外,为了实现抖音的短视频录制功能,我们可以使用uni-app的uni-media-capture插件,该插件可以实现拍摄、录制和选择图片等功能,从而实现用户在应用中录制短视频的需求。
此外,为了实现抖音的用户关注、评论、分享等功能,我们可以使用uni-app的网络请求API来连接服务端,实现用户的登录注册、获取视频列表、点赞评论等操作。
最后,为了提升应用的用户体验和交互性,我们可以使用uni-app的动画组件和过渡效果来实现视频的翻转、缩放等特效,以及实现页面之间的平滑切换。
总结起来,UniApp是一个非常适合实现类似抖音短视频应用的开发框架,通过使用UniApp提供的组件、API和插件,我们可以轻松开发出功能丰富、界面精美的仿抖音应用程序。
### 回答2:
UniApp是一个跨平台开发框架,能够快速实现将同一份代码运行在多个不同平台的功能。而抖音是一款非常火爆的短视频分享平台,因此有很多开发者希望使用UniApp进行仿抖音的开发。
首先,要实现UniApp仿抖音的源码,需要准备好开发环境。首先,需要安装Node.js和HBuilderX,Node.js是一种轻量级的JavaScript运行环境,HBuilderX是一款适用于UniApp开发的集成开发环境。
接下来,可以创建一个新的UniApp项目。在HBuilderX中,可以选择创建一个新的UniApp项目,然后选择合适的模板,如视频应用。之后,可以根据自己的需求进行一些配置,如应用的名称、图标等。
在项目中,可以使用Vue框架进行开发。Vue是一种用于构建用户界面的渐进式框架,非常适用于UniApp的开发。可以通过编写Vue组件的方式来实现页面的布局和交互逻辑。
在仿抖音的开发中,需要实现视频播放、视频上传和用户信息管理等功能。UniApp提供了丰富的API和组件,可以方便地实现这些功能。可以使用uni-ui来快速构建页面,如头部导航、视频列表等。
此外,还可以通过调用第三方的接口来获取抖音的相关数据。可以使用uni.request来发送HTTP请求,获取抖音的视频列表、用户信息等数据。在获取到数据后,可以使用Vue的数据绑定机制将数据渲染到页面上。
最后,还需要注意一些性能优化和适配的问题。由于UniApp是跨平台的开发框架,因此需要考虑不同平台的差异。可以使用条件编译或者CSS媒体查询来实现对不同平台的适配。此外,还可以使用uni-app的优化工具来对项目进行性能优化,如图片压缩、代码压缩等。
总结起来,实现UniApp仿抖音的源码需要准备好开发环境,创建一个UniApp项目,使用Vue框架进行开发,实现视频播放、上传和用户管理等功能,并注意性能优化和适配的问题。希望以上回答能够对您有所帮助。
阅读全文